Meaning of "never the twain shall meet"
never the twain shall meet ~ a phrase that conveys the idea that two things are so fundamentally different or incompatible that they are unlikely to unite or come together. It implies a clear division or separation between two entities that cannot be reconciled
Show more definitions
- Used to emphasize that two subjects are so different that they cannot coexist or agree with each other.
